This report explores the use of the ISA/IEC 62443 series of standards for industrial automation and control systems (IACS) that include cloud-based functionality (i.e., industrial internet of things (IIoT)).

The scope of an “IIoT IACS” includes all the systems and components necessary for a complete IACS including sensors, actuators and controllers at the edge, services in the cloud and the communications between edge and cloud. This report is a companion to the “IIoT Component Certification Based on the 62443 Standard” study, which explores the use of ISA/IEC 62443-4-2, “Technical security requirements for IACS components” for IIoT components.
